/tə ɪnˈflɪkt dɛθ ˈpɛnəlti/ – Phrase
Definition: kết án tử hình.
A more thorough explanation: “To inflict death penalty” means to carry out the legal punishment of putting a person to death as a result of a criminal conviction, typically through methods such as hanging, electrocution, lethal injection, or firing squad.
Example: The judge decided to inflict the death penalty on the convicted murderer.
